The specialized freight trucking industry in the United States is a significant economic force, worth over $125 billion annually. This robust sector is experiencing steady growth, driven primarily by nationwide infrastructure projects and the increasing demand for renewable energy transport.
Scale is a defining characteristic of this industry, with more than 10 million oversize/overweight permits issued annually across the country. These permits primarily facilitate the transport of construction equipment, generators, turbines, and agricultural machinery.
Most heavy hauls involve substantial loads weighing between 40,000 to 120,000 pounds and spanning up to 20 feet wide, highlighting the specialized expertise required for safe and efficient transport.
California stands out among the top three states for oversize transport demand, a position attributed to its bustling ports, extensive agricultural operations, and thriving technology manufacturing centers.
Coastal states like California face additional complexity due to environmental protection zones along transport routes, with approximately 15% of heavy hauls involving marine-related industries.
Customer expectations in this specialized industry are clear and demanding. A recent industry survey revealed that 92% of heavy equipment buyers consider on-time delivery and damage-free transport their top priorities.

Navigating heavy haul regulations in North Carolina requires a thorough understanding of the North Carolina Department of Transportation (NCDOT) guidelines. NCDOT oversees all aspects of permitting and enforcement for oversize and overweight loads, ensuring the safety and integrity of the state's infrastructure.
North Carolina utilizes a tiered permit system, distinguishing between divisible and non-divisible loads. The process involves submitting a detailed application, including load dimensions, weight, and route, to the NCDOT Permit Office. Understanding these nuances is critical for smooth transport operations.
North Carolina's approach to oversize/overweight loads balances the needs of commerce with the preservation of its infrastructure. The state actively monitors and enforces regulations, requiring strict adherence to permitted routes and weight limits. Pre-planning and accurate permit applications are key to avoiding delays and penalties.
Standard weight limits on North Carolina highways are as follows: 20,000 pounds on a single axle, 34,000 pounds on a tandem axle, and a maximum gross vehicle weight of 80,000 pounds. These limits apply to vehicles without special permits.
North Carolina does not typically enforce seasonal weight restrictions like some northern states. However, specific routes, particularly those traversing older bridges or environmentally sensitive areas, may have reduced weight limits. Always verify route-specific restrictions with the NCDOT.
The maximum legal dimensions for vehicles operating on North Carolina highways without a permit are 8 feet 6 inches in width, 13 feet 6 inches in height, and 40 feet in length for single vehicles. For combinations, the overall length is typically limited to 60 feet, but can vary based on configuration.
Permits are required for any load exceeding these dimensions. Oversize loads necessitate careful route planning, potential escort vehicles, and adherence to specific time-of-day travel restrictions. The need for a permit is evaluated on a case-by-case basis by the NCDOT.
Escort vehicles are required in North Carolina when the load exceeds specific dimensions. Generally, one escort is required for loads exceeding 12 feet in width, 14 feet 6 inches in height, or 90 feet in length. Specific circumstances, such as highway type and traffic conditions, can also trigger escort requirements.
Police escorts may be mandated for extremely oversized or overweight loads, particularly those traversing high-traffic areas or requiring temporary lane closures. The NCDOT will determine the necessity of a police escort based on the specifics of the load and route. These are typically more expensive and require additional coordination.
Applications for oversize/overweight permits in North Carolina are submitted to the NCDOT Permit Office, located in Raleigh. The official website is ncdot.gov, and the permit office can be reached at (919) 733-7154. Online applications are generally processed more quickly.
Required documentation includes a detailed description of the load, its dimensions and weight, the origin and destination, the proposed route, and vehicle registration information. For overweight loads, axle weights and spacing are also crucial. A certificate of insurance may also be required.
Typical permit processing time is 3-5 business days for standard applications. More complex permits, particularly those involving multiple jurisdictions or requiring engineering review, may take longer. Fees vary based on the size and weight of the load, as well as the duration of the permit. Expect to pay anywhere from $25 to several hundred dollars, depending on the specifics.
Certain highways and bridges in North Carolina have posted weight or size restrictions. These restrictions are often due to structural limitations or ongoing construction. It's crucial to consult the NCDOT's website or contact the permit office to identify any restricted routes along your planned path. I-95 and I-40 are generally accessible, but local routes should be thoroughly vetted.
Time-of-day restrictions apply to oversize loads in many areas of North Carolina, particularly near major cities. Travel may be prohibited during peak hours (typically 7:00 AM - 9:00 AM and 4:00 PM - 6:00 PM) on weekdays. Weekend travel may also be restricted in certain areas. Specific restrictions are detailed in the permit.
Major cities like Charlotte, Raleigh, Greensboro, and Winston-Salem have stricter regulations regarding oversize/overweight transport due to higher traffic volumes and denser infrastructure. These cities often require additional permits or impose more stringent time-of-day restrictions. Careful planning and communication with local authorities are essential.
